Alan Rickman began his acting career in the theater, where he gained recognition for his performances in productions of plays by Shakespeare and other classic playwrights. He later transitioned to film and television, where he quickly became known for his ability to play complex, nuanced characters with great skill and depth.


Rickman's breakthrough role came in 1988, when he was cast as the villainous Hans Gruber in the action film "Die Hard." The role earned him widespread acclaim and established him as a major Hollywood talent. He went on to star in a number of other successful films, including "Robin Hood: Prince of Thieves," "Sense and Sensibility," and "Love Actually."


In the 2000s, Rickman became best known for his role as Professor Severus Snape in the "Harry Potter" film series. His portrayal of Snape, a complex and conflicted character with a tragic backstory, earned him critical acclaim and a dedicated fan following.


In addition to his acting work, Rickman was also a skilled director and producer. He directed several successful stage productions in the UK, and he also directed and produced several films, including "The Winter Guest" and "A Little Chaos."
